2026-08-28

In the 2026 summer‑autumn season, Typhoons Bavi (No.9), White Dolphin (No.13) and Sader (No.18) made successive landfalls in Kanmen subdistrict, Yuhuan, Taizhou, Zhejiang, a new meteorological record for East China coastal landfalls. Meteorologists attribute the clustering to the rapid development of El Niño: anomalous warming in the central‑eastern equatorial Pacific has altered typhoon genesis and steering. In El Niño years the western Pacific subtropical high tends to be stronger and displaced northward, guiding typhoons on northwest tracks toward the East China coast. This season most storms avoided Taiwan’s topographic blocking and thus retained strength at landfall. Historical data show about 15 typhoons that landed in Zhejiang occurred in El Niño development years (roughly one‑third); among the most damaging Zhejiang storms on record, 1997’s Winnie and 2006’s Saomai also occurred in El Niño years.
